Harry Warden is a leading real estate attorney based in Little Rock, Arkansas. He focuses his practice on real estate law, landlord representation, criminal law, and DWI defense.
Recognized as a Rising Star in the Mid-South by Super Lawyers®, Harry provides his clients with the legal expertise they need to navigate the eviction/unlawful detainer procedure, criminal charges, and other legal issues that arise for landlords and individuals in Arkansas, Oklahoma, and Texas.
He received his Bachelor of Business Administration degree from the University of Oklahoma (Summa Cum Laude) and received his Juris Doctor from the University of Oklahoma College of Law (graduating with honors). Harry was Research Editor for the American Indian Law Review.
During his practice, Harry has represented a wide range of clients, including private and publicly traded companies. He has also represented local individuals and families and has represented over 100 pro bono clients. Ludwig Warden PLC’s Real Estate practice provides comprehensive counsel to individuals, businesses, investors, landlords, and property owners across Arkansas. The firm advises on both commercial and residential real estate matters, guiding clients through transactions and disputes with a focus on protecting their financial and property interests.
The practice handles purchase and sale agreements, deed preparation, mortgages and promissory notes, commercial and residential leasing, title examinations and insurance, quiet title actions, foreclosures, and 1031 exchanges. Its attorneys also advise landlords and tenants on lease negotiations, evictions, and other issues arising from property ownership and occupancy.
Ludwig Warden also has significant real estate litigation capabilities, representing clients in contract, property boundary, easement, adverse possession, landlord-tenant, foreclosure, construction, and title disputes.
